JAMES E. DUFFY, OF CHICAGO, ILLINOIS.
WHIP-LOCK.
Specification of Letters Patent.
Patented July 26, 1910.
Application filed May 18, 1910. Serial No. 561,952.
To all whom it may concern:
Be it known that 1, JAMES E. DUFFY, a citizen of the United States, residing at Chicage, in the county of'Cook and State of. Illinois, have invented new and useful Improvements in VVhip-Locks, of which the following is a specification.
This invention relates to whip locks, the object being to provide a Whip socket with a locking device whereby the whip may be readily locked in place in the whip socket so that unauthorized persons will not be able to remove the whip, at least without the exercise of a great deal of skill and manipulation in breaking the lock.
To such ends this invention consists in certain novel features of construction and arrangement, a description of which will be found in the following specification and the essential features ofwhich will be more definitely pointed out in the claims appended hereto.
The invention is clearly illustrated in the drawing furnished herewith, in which- Figure 1 is a central longitudinal section through a whip socket showing in front elevation, my locking device and a fragment of a whip secured in the socket by means of said locking device, Fig. 2 is a central longitudinal section of the whip socket taken on the line 22 of Fig. 1 and showing the locking device in side elevation and the whip in a position about to be connected with the locking device, Fig. 3 is a horizon tal section on the line 33 of Fig. land Fig. 4 is a central longitudinal section through a fragment of a whip socket showing in side elevation a fragment of a whip and whip lock in a slightly modified form.
Referring to the drawings, an ordinary whip socket A, will be seen which is tubular in form having a closed bottom a. A frag ment of a whip B, is shown as secured in the socket by means of my improved locking device C. In the preferred form said locking device comprises a curved plate 10, secured in the whip socket and a pin or stud 11, secured to the lower end of the whip stock and adapted to be locked to said plate. The plate 10, is semi-circular in form and practically fits against the inner face of the whip socket and is secured in place therein, as for instance by means of a pin or nail 12, ex-
tending through the adjacent walls of the plate and socket and a tongue 13, at the lower end of the plate which passes through is extremely intricate and difiicult to follow when it is hidden from View, as it is while covered up by the wall of the whip socket.
From the entrance opening 15, said slot has an upwardly extending portion 16, terminating in a notch 17, extending toward the right. Slightly above the point of entrance 15,"the slot runs to the left as at 18, then down as at 19, to a horizontal portion 20, which terminates in a downwardly extending and right angled portion 21, 21 In the horizontal portion 20, is a downwardly opening notch 22, and opposite a tongue 23, is
.an upwardly extending portion 24, which leads to another horizontal portion 25, con
taining offset portions 26, 27. Extending up from said horizontal portion 25, is another vertical extension 28, which terminates in a horizontal portion 29, having vertically extending notches 30, 31, that extend in opposite direction from said horizontal portion 29.
The pin orstud 11, may of course besecured in the whip stock in any desired manner, as for instance it may be screwed therein, and projects beyond the face of the whip stock sufliciently to form a firm bearing on the marginal edges of the irregular slot 14:, in the plate 10.
The whip is locked in place by inserting it into the socket, bringing the pin or stud 11, down along the edge 0, of the plate 10, and then turning it around toward the left, as viewed in the drawing, and bringing it up into the entrance 15, of the irregular slot 14. The pin may then be moved through said slot into any one of the recesses thereof and I have shown the pin in the end of the horizontal ofiset portion 26. To detach the whip, the pin should be moved in the direction taken by the arrows in Fig. 1. It is obvious that when said plate 10, is covered by the wall of the whip socket, it is an exceedingly difficult matter to trace the direction which the pin should take in removing it from the irregular slot in view of the many turns and abutments with which it comes in contact in moving about in the irregular slot. One knowing the shape of said slot .may, however, easily follow the same and quickly bring the pin to the entrance opening 15, after which the whip may be withdrawn. For the guidance of the owner a mark D, is placed upon the whip, which mark indicates, by reason of its position relative to the upper edge of the whip socket, the exact location of the in 11, in the irregular slot 14. WVith this guide before him the owner can more readily locate the position of the pin and guide it out of the slot. For his further guidance, a card may be printed, bearing a facsimile of the slot in the plate, which card may be used by the owner to guide him in moving the pin out of its locked position.
The edge C of the locking plate opposite the entrance 15, is straight and unbroken, so that the user may slide the pin 11, along this edge when he wishes to have the socket support the whip without locking it, the whip being then free to be withdrawn at any time, as for instance when he wishes to have the whip in readiness for use.
In the modified form shown in Fig. 4 the curved plate C is shown as secured to the whip stock B and the pin 11 secured in the wall of the whip socket A so as to project into the socket or hollow thereof. The irregular slot 14 of any suitable shape is formed in the plate C and the operation of locking or unlocking the whip is substantially the same as that of the preferred form.
I am aware that various alterations and modifications of this device are possible without departing from the spirit of my invention, and I do not therefore desire to limit myself to the exact form of construction and arragement shown and described.
I claim as new and desire to secure by Letters Patent:
1. A whip lock comprising in combination, a whip socket, a whip, a plate having an irregular trackway therein and secured to one of said members and a projection secured to the other of said members and adapted to seat in said irregular trackway of the plate to lock the whip in the socket.
2. A whip lock comprising in combination, a whip socket, a whip, a plate of semicircular form secured to said whip socket and having an irregular slot formed therein, comprising vertical and horizontal ofiset portions and an entrance opening, and a projection on the whip adapted to be moved into said slot to lock the whip in the socket.
3. A whip lock comprising in combination, a whip socket, a whip, a curved plate secured in said whip socket and having a slot of irregular form comprising an entrance opening and a continuous slot having offset notches extending back therefrom, and a stud projecting from the whip and adapted to be inserted in said slot to lock the whip in the socket.
4. A whip lock comprising in combination, a whip socket, a whip, a curved plate secured in said whip socket and having a slot of irregular form comprising an entrance opening and a continuous slot having offset notches extending back therefrom, a stud projecting from the whip and. adapted to be inserted in said slot to lock the whip in the socket, and a mark upon said whip for determining the location of said pin in the slot.
